Re: New cigars
I'll buy 3, let them sit in my humi for a week and make sure it will be the first cigar of the day. Revisit in another week or two and repeat. At this point I have a good idea whether a box is in my future.
Limited releases I just bite the bullet if I think they will be something I will like. Needless to say I have a bunch of boxes that I hope get better.....eventually. |
